Understanding the Role of Refrigerant in Your HVAC System
Refrigerant serves as the medium that allows heat transfer within your air conditioning or heat pump system. It absorbs heat from the indoor air and releases it outside, keeping indoor temperatures comfortable during warm months. Without refrigerant, the system simply cannot function.
However, over time, even well-maintained systems can experience degradation. Vibrations, corrosion, and improper sealing can weaken the refrigerant lines and joints. The combination of environmental exposure and mechanical wear makes ongoing monitoring essential. When pressure drops, cooling efficiency decreases, which stresses the compressor and shortens the system’s lifespan.

The Most Common Causes of Refrigerant Leaks
Refrigerant leaks rarely happen overnight — they develop gradually as parts wear out or materials corrode. Understanding the causes can help you target preventive actions more effectively.
The primary reasons include:
- Corrosion in copper coils caused by exposure to formic acid or airborne chemicals.
- Excessive vibration from unbalanced or failing fan motors, which shake fittings loose.
- Improper installation during new HVAC installation projects, especially if joints were not properly brazed.
- Natural wear and tear that weakens valves, gaskets, or capillary tubing.
- Accidental damage to refrigerant lines during unrelated maintenance work.
Even small leaks can have major consequences. A system that loses just 10% of its refrigerant can see its efficiency drop by 20%, according to data from the U.S. Department of Energy. That’s why early detection and prevention are so valuable.

Recognizing the Early Warning Signs of a Leak
Detecting a leak early is key to preventing major damage. Some of the most common signs include:
- Hissing or bubbling noises coming from the indoor or outdoor unit.
- Ice formation on evaporator coils or refrigerant lines.
- Poor airflow and longer cooling cycles.
- Rising energy bills even when usage hasn’t changed.
- Reduced cooling performance or warm air blowing from vents.

Effective Strategies to Prevent Refrigerant Leaks
The most effective way to prevent refrigerant leaks is through regular maintenance and attention to detail during installation. Below are proven strategies that keep your HVAC system leak-free and efficient year-round.
Schedule Regular Maintenance
A professional inspection twice a year — before the heating and cooling seasons — helps identify issues early. Technicians check for proper pressure, inspect joints and connections, and look for signs of corrosion or vibration.
Keep Coils Clean and Protected
Dust and debris trap moisture on coils, accelerating corrosion. Scheduling coil cleaning for peak performance removes buildup that could eventually cause refrigerant line weakness. Clean coils also allow heat exchange to occur more efficiently.
Inspect Fan Motors and Blades
Vibrations from worn fan motors or unbalanced blades are a leading cause of mechanical stress on refrigerant lines. Regular fan motor services can prevent these vibrations, ensuring stable operation and extending the lifespan of both residential and commercial systems.
Use High-Quality Components During Installation
Cutting corners with cheap materials or unqualified labor is one of the fastest ways to end up with a refrigerant leak. Always rely on certified professionals for new HVAC installation, ensuring all brazed joints, fittings, and seals meet industry standards.
Monitor Pressure Levels and System Performance
Advanced monitoring tools and smart thermostats can detect performance irregularities early. When system pressure or temperature fluctuates, it’s often a sign of a small leak or developing problem. Setting up automated alerts ensures issues are addressed before they cause damage.
Keep the Outdoor Unit Clear
Leaves, dirt, and debris can restrict airflow and trap moisture around condenser coils, which may cause corrosion. Regularly inspect and clean the outdoor unit, ensuring at least two feet of clearance around it.
Replace Aging Equipment
If your system is over a decade old, consider upgrading to a newer, more efficient model. Modern systems use environmentally friendly refrigerants and feature improved sealing technologies, minimizing leak risks.
The Value of Professional Maintenance
While some basic tasks like cleaning filters or checking vents can be handled by homeowners, refrigerant handling is not one of them. According to EPA regulations, only certified professionals can manage refrigerants safely.
Professional maintenance includes checking refrigerant levels, testing for leaks, tightening connections, and performing nitrogen pressure tests. A trained technician can also recharge the system correctly and ensure it operates at manufacturer specifications.

FAQ
How often should my HVAC system be checked for leaks?
At least twice a year — once before cooling season and once before heating season — to ensure refrigerant levels and seals are intact.
Can refrigerant sealant fix leaks permanently?
No, sealants only provide a temporary patch. The proper solution is identifying and repairing the leak source by a certified technician.
What are the main symptoms of low refrigerant?
Warm air from vents, ice on coils, unusual noises, and higher electricity bills are all signs your refrigerant may be low.
Are refrigerant leaks harmful to health?
Small leaks generally aren’t dangerous, but large leaks can displace oxygen in enclosed spaces and cause dizziness or headaches.
